The racking inspection training courses provide practical experience in examining warehouse racking, identifying defects, assessing their significance and recording findings clearly. Through guided inspection exercises and realistic workplace examples, attendees learn how to apply inspection principles consistently rather than relying on visual checks alone.
Guided inspection practice forms a central part of the training. Attendees work through a structured inspection process, considering the condition of uprights, beams, bracing, protection, connections, pallets and surrounding areas. The exercises demonstrate how to inspect systematically, including areas that can be missed during a quick walk-through.
The training also covers how to approach different inspection conditions. Attendees learn to consider access, visibility, housekeeping, lighting, loading activity and the way warehouse racking is being used. This helps them distinguish between a complete inspection and a limited visual check, and understand when further investigation may be necessary.
Hazard identification exercises help attendees recognise common sources of risk. These may include impact damage, displaced or overloaded components, missing or damaged safety equipment, unsuitable pallets, unprotected exposed areas and changes to the warehouse racking configuration. Practical examples show why the cause of a defect matters, not just its appearance.
Damage assessment is taught using representative examples of faults and deterioration. Attendees practise deciding whether damage affects a structural component, a protective feature or the safe use of the warehouse racking. They also learn to avoid common errors, such as treating every mark as equally serious or overlooking damage because the system remains in use.
The course introduces a consistent approach to risk classification. Attendees consider the location, extent and likely effect of a defect, together with the loading and operating conditions. They practise determining when action should be taken immediately, when an item should be monitored or when competent technical advice is required. The training reinforces that a classification must be supported by an accurate description of the observed condition.
Recording findings is another important practical skill. Attendees learn how to describe the location of a defect, identify the affected component, note relevant observations and support the entry with suitable photographs or reference points where appropriate. Clear records make it easier for warehouse teams, managers and repair specialists to understand what has been found and what action is required.
Practical exercises also cover the preparation of inspection reports and action lists. Attendees practise separating observations from recommendations, prioritising remedial work and identifying issues that require follow-up. This supports effective communication with the person responsible for warehouse safety and helps prevent defects from being lost in general maintenance records.
The training explains how to recommend proportionate corrective action without exceeding the inspector’s role. Depending on the finding, this may involve removing a damaged area from use, reducing exposure to risk, arranging repair or replacement, improving housekeeping, checking loading practices or seeking assessment from a suitably competent specialist. Attendees learn why repairs should not be improvised or carried out without confirming that the proposed solution is appropriate.
Where the course is delivered with site-based or applied activities, the instructor can relate the exercises to the warehouse racking and working practices in the customer’s environment. Where learning is delivered remotely, the same principles are developed through photographs, inspection scenarios, diagrams, report-writing tasks and instructor-led discussion. In both formats, the emphasis is on applying knowledge to realistic inspection decisions.
By the end of the practical element, attendees should be better prepared to carry out a structured warehouse racking inspection, recognise conditions that require attention, record evidence accurately and communicate suitable next steps. The training supports competent day-to-day inspection activity; it does not replace specialist engineering assessment where damage, alteration or unusual loading requires a more detailed technical evaluation.
